On March 23, Muse will release documentary on DVD entitled Under Review. With rare footage, new clips, location shoots, videos and rare photographs, the film takes a look at the band’s entire career in a variety of ways. The DVD includes exclusive interviews with former manager Safta Jaffrey, legendary producer John Leckie, band engineer Ric Peet, video director Mat Kirby, official biographer and NME writer Mark Beaumont and many other close confidantes.
